Competence, Technology and Defence on the Agenda as Maritime Industry Provides Input to New Maritime Strategy

Les saken på norsk

How can Norway secure sufficient maritime competence as technology develops rapidly and competition for skilled labour intensifies? This was a key question when Minister of Fisheries and Ocean Policy Marianne Sivertsen Næss met with the maritime industry in Trondheim to gather input for the Norwegian Government’s new maritime strategy.

The meeting was organised by Maritimt Forum on 20 August, bringing together representatives from shipping companies, the maritime supply industry, research and education institutions, and employee organisations. Recruitment and competence were the main themes, while autonomy, new technology, the green transition, defence, security and preparedness were also important topics.

Fride Solbakken, CEO of Maritimt Forum, welcomed the participants, while Ellen Weidemann from Maritimt Forum Midt-Norge chaired the meeting.

Before the meeting at Sealab in Brattørkaia, the minister visited NTNU’s research vessel Gunnerus at Pir 2, where she was given a presentation and tour by Inger Jennings from NTNU.

From Gunnerus to maritime technology

The visit demonstrated how research, education and technology development come together in the maritime sector. Gunnerus is used for research, teaching and as a test platform for new technology, including robots, drones and advanced sensor systems.

Students work with real-world datasets and challenges from maritime operations, providing a practical example of the competence the industry needs: people who understand both the technology and the maritime operations in which it is applied.

The minister showed considerable interest in the technology and competence environments presented during the visit.

“Competence and recruitment are our biggest challenges”

Kristin Bugten Alsaker, HR Manager at Berge Rederi/Transmar, highlighted recruitment and competence as among the maritime industry’s biggest challenges.

Berge Rederi is preparing to take delivery of BRF Froan, a new battery-electric bulk carrier. The development of increasingly advanced vessels is also creating new competence requirements for crews.

“Competence and recruitment are our biggest challenges,” said Alsaker.

At the same time, the discussion underlined that new technology does not make seamanship and domain knowledge less important.

“The research frontier is now moving towards fully robotised organisations, but that is not realistic at full scale in the foreseeable future. Seamanship and the domain knowledge people carry in their heads will remain the most important.”

Technology also depends on fundamental expertise

Ketil Aagesen from Siemens Energy noted that the company has around 400 employees in Trondheim and works closely with NTNU and SINTEF.

He emphasised the importance of maintaining strong technology environments and industrial activity in Norway.

“If we are to continue doing this without moving activity to other parts of the world, we need that connection,” said Aagesen.

He also cautioned that the attention given to artificial intelligence and other cutting-edge technologies must not come at the expense of the fundamental technologies on which further development depends.

Education and research must be connected to industry

Bjørn Egil Asbjørnslett from NTNU highlighted the university’s role in educating both operational personnel and technology and systems specialists.

“We provide substantial education both for operational personnel and for technology and systems specialists within maritime and marine engineering disciplines,” said Asbjørnslett.

Arne Fredheim from SINTEF Ocean highlighted the Norwegian Ocean Technology Centre as an important arena for collaboration between research, education and industry.

“The Ocean Technology Centre is to become a world-leading marine research and education centre, but perhaps equally important, an innovation system where NTNU, SINTEF, industry and other users develop solutions together.”

He also stressed the importance of ensuring that smaller companies have access to the infrastructure needed to test and develop new solutions.

Autonomy and defence high on the agenda

The technology discussions extended beyond efficiency and the green transition. Autonomy, defence, security and preparedness were important themes at the meeting, underlining the growing connection between the maritime and defence sectors.

Vegard Evjen Hovstein, CEO and co-founder of Maritime Robotics, presented the company’s work with autonomous and unmanned maritime systems and its growing relevance to the defence market. He emphasised the importance of Norway itself acting as a customer and reference market for technology developed by Norwegian companies.

“It is a paradox that, as a leading autonomy and research environment, we do not have our own state as a larger customer,” said Hovstein.

The discussion highlighted how maritime technology is increasingly relevant to defence and national preparedness, including through autonomous systems, sensors and unmanned platforms.

For Norway, this creates opportunities to build on capabilities developed in the maritime sector and apply them across both civilian and defence-related domains.

A broad need for competence

The meeting brought together a broad range of industry perspectives. Arild Petter Nubdal, CEO of Moen Verft, represented the shipbuilding and maritime supply industry. Frøygruppen represented the aquaculture sector, while Simon Møkster Shipping and the Norwegian Officers’ and Engineers’ Association contributed perspectives from offshore operations and the workforce.

Together, the participants demonstrated the breadth of competence required across the maritime sector – from skilled workers and seafarers to engineers, technologists, researchers and other specialists.

Competition for skilled labour is taking place across the Norwegian economy. Making maritime education and careers attractive to younger generations is therefore an important part of the challenge.

A maritime strategy with implications beyond shipping

The minister emphasised that input from industry is important to the development of the new maritime strategy and invited written submissions following the meeting.

The discussions in Trondheim demonstrated that the strategy must take a broad perspective. Maritime technology and competence are important not only to shipping, but also to aquaculture, fisheries, offshore operations and offshore wind and increasingly to defence, security and national preparedness.

The meeting also highlighted the strategic value of Norway’s maritime technology and industrial base. Autonomy, unmanned systems, sensors and other technologies developed for maritime applications can contribute to both commercial innovation and national security.

For Norway to maintain its strong maritime position, continued investment in research, technology development and competence will be essential.

New technology is changing how the maritime industry operates. But the need for people who can combine technology with maritime experience, domain knowledge and operational understanding is not diminishing. It is becoming more important.
